5G Mobile Communication Network Site Planning And Regional Clustering Problems
The location and planning of base stations, which are related to the quality of communication services and the construction cost of base stations, are highlights of widespread concern in the field of communication. Based on the analysis of existing base station locations of the 5G mobile communication network, the article adopts the immune genetic algorithm and DBSCAN algorithm to mathematically model and analyze the types and locations of new base stations. The base station locations are reasonably planned to achieve the optimization of cost and coverage conditions. Clustering analysis of different weak coverage areas is done to realize the partition management of different weak coverage areas, which makes it possible to better solve the weak coverage problem.
